1use std::fmt;
2
3use crate::{capitalize, transform};
4
5pub trait ToTitleCase: ToOwned {
19 fn to_title_case(&self) -> Self::Owned;
21}
22
23impl ToTitleCase for str {
24 fn to_title_case(&self) -> String {
25 AsTitleCase(self).to_string()
26 }
27}
28
29pub struct AsTitleCase<T: AsRef<str>>(pub T);
40
41impl<T: AsRef<str>> fmt::Display for AsTitleCase<T> {
42 fn fmt(&self, f: &mut fmt::Formatter) -> fmt::Result {
43 transform(self.0.as_ref(), capitalize, |f| write!(f, " "), f)
44 }
45}
46
47#[cfg(test)]
48mod tests {
49 use super::ToTitleCase;
50
51 macro_rules! t {
52 ($t:ident : $s1:expr => $s2:expr) => {
53 #[test]
54 fn $t() {
55 assert_eq!($s1.to_title_case(), $s2)
56 }
57 };
58 }
59
60 t!(test1: "CamelCase" => "Camel Case");
61 t!(test2: "This is Human case." => "This Is Human Case");
62 t!(test3: "MixedUP CamelCase, with some Spaces" => "Mixed Up Camel Case With Some Spaces");
63 t!(test4: "mixed_up_ snake_case, with some _spaces" => "Mixed Up Snake Case With Some Spaces");
64 t!(test5: "kebab-case" => "Kebab Case");
65 t!(test6: "SHOUTY_SNAKE_CASE" => "Shouty Snake Case");
66 t!(test7: "snake_case" => "Snake Case");
67 t!(test8: "this-contains_ ALLKinds OfWord_Boundaries" => "This Contains All Kinds Of Word Boundaries");
68 #[cfg(feature = "unicode")]
69 t!(test9: "XΣXΣ baffle" => "Xσxς Baffle");
70 t!(test10: "XMLHttpRequest" => "Xml Http Request");
71}
